The IHP consists of approximately 230 research staff, primarily in the area of wireless communications, including SiGe-based technologies, diagnostics, and materials research. We are working in a multidisciplinary environment, spanning materials, process technology, circuits, and systems. The IHP is housed in a state-of-the-art building 55 minutes from Berlin, with ultra-modern facilities. Our innovations are in worldwide demand.
We are seeking candidates with a Master or PhD degree in Electrical Engineering, Communications, or Physics for exciting circuit design tasks in a new project on Ultra-High Bandwidth Low-Power Signal Processing.
The research focus is on analog circuit design for bringing complex ultra-fast digital performance beyond the state of the art in terms of speed and power. This requires a multi-level approach including digital system viewpoint, RF design, analog circuit design, device geometry optimization. The research involves simulation, circuit design and measurement of analog and digital signal processing at various levels of abstraction at 10-50 GHz clock rate in 130 nm SiGe BiCMOS.
